if interested in history Bethuli offers the history of the site of a Boer War British concentration camp. Trudy Venter curator of the local museum and author of books on the war and surroundings is well worth contacting for a guided tour.

Bethulie has a lost history of the worst Boer War concentration camp set up by the British. Trudie Venter a local resident, Author and historian provided us with insight into the history of Bethuli and surroundings. Bethuli is a very small village, however gives you easy access to the surrounding areas.
